“…Georeferenced underwater photogrammetry is rarer. It may be performed by unmanned vehicles such as AUVs through their navigation system (Kwasnitschka et al., ), or by underwater ROVs with acoustic transducers (Drap et al., ) and towed devices (Rende et al., 2015a). Although producing high‐resolution orthophotographs and 3D models, these techniques have a low positioning accuracy, of the order of several metres, due to the distance between the AUV/ROV and the main ship providing geolocation for the first two (Paull et al., ); and the uncertainties generated by the length and angle of the cable towing the device for the latter (El‐Hawary, ).…”
